Wearable devices present practical solutions to three critical areas where women’s health research lags behind clinical needs. First, continuous monitoring during hormonal cycles traditionally excluded from research protocols could reveal how hormonal fluctuations influence disease manifestation and treatment efficacy—particularly important for the 85% of women’s health issues involving reproductive health. Second, real-world cardiovascular data collection could capture disease patterns unique to women, whose heart disease symptoms often differ from clinical presentations documented in male-dominated research. Third, objective mental health tracking through wearables could improve diagnosis and monitoring of conditions affecting women at higher rates, addressing the current reliance on subjective reporting. These applications underscore how wearable technology transcends theoretical promise to offer clinicians and researchers tangible tools for personalized, evidence-based women’s healthcare. Implementation requires addressing data standardization and validation challenges, but the potential benefits for closing gender health gaps are substantial.
